Riassunto
The Giant Defy is an endurance road bike praised for its lightweight design, comfortable ride quality, and versatile performance. It features advanced carbon engineering, such as the D-Fuse seatpost and handlebar, which enhance vibration damping while maintaining efficiency. The bike offers quick handling and stability, with increased tire clearance up to 38mm for added adaptability.

| Telaio | Advanced-Grade Composite, disc Standard BB: BB86/BB92, Movimento Centrale Tolleranza pneumatici: 35c Colore: Airglow |
|---|---|
| Forcella | Advanced-Grade Composite, full-composite OverDrive 2 steerer, disc |
| Ammortizzatore posteriore | N/A |
| Bottom Bracket | Shimano, press fit |
| Stem | Giant Contact SL XS:80mm, S:90mm, M:100mm, M/L:100mm, L:110mm, XL:110mm |
| Manubrio | Giant Contact SLR D-Fuse XS:40cm, S:40cm, M:42cm, M/L:42cm, L:44cm, XL:44cm |
| Sella | Giant Fleet SL |
| Reggisella | Giant D-Fuse SLR, composite, -5/+15mm offset Tipo: Rigido |
| Pedali | N/A |
| Manopole | Stratus Lite 3.0 |
| Deragliatore posteriore | Shimano Ultegra Di2 RD-R8150 |
|---|---|
| Deragliatore anteriore | Shimano Ultegra Di2 FD-R8150 |
| Manovella | Shimano Ultegra, 34/50 XS:170mm, S:170mm, M:172.5mm, M/L:172.5mm, L:175mm, XL:175mm |
| Leve del cambio | Shimano Ultegra Di2 ST-R8170 |
| Cassetta | Shimano Ultegra, 12-speed, 11x34 |
| Catena | Shimano Ultegra |
| Freni | Shimano Ultegra Di2 hydraulic, Shimano RT-MT800 rotors [F]160mm, [R]140mm Tipo: Shimano Ultegra Disco idraulici |
| Leve freno | Shimano Ultegra Di2 |
| Cerchi | Giant SLR 1 36 Carbon Disc WheelSystem |
|---|---|
| Raggi | Sapim CX-Ray |
| Mozzo anteriore | [F] Giant Low Friction Hub, CenterLock, 12mm thru-axle, [R] Giant Low Friction Hub, 30t ratchet driver, CenterLock, 12mm thru-axle |
| Mozzo posteriore | [F] Giant Low Friction Hub, CenterLock, 12mm thru-axle, [R] Giant Low Friction Hub, 30t ratchet driver, CenterLock, 12mm thru-axle |
| Pneumatici | Giant Gavia Fondo 0, tubeless, 700x32c (33.5mm), folding |
